# Reportsmith — Environments & Timezones

If you're on call and someone says "my export is off by a few hours," it's almost always timezone config drift between environments. Staging pins everything to UTC; prod respects the tenant's locale setting, and dev is honestly a bit of a free-for-all. Check the values first, escalate second. Current per-environment settings are below.

config for tawif-bagef:
[sorwyn]
team = sorys
access_code = ac_9ba40c
host = sorwyn.ordingrid.local
port = 5000
owner = aldok.quenion
peer = belath.paliqcloud.local

Runbook fragment — Pixelmoor thumbnail queue. If thumbnail generation backs up past 10k items, pause the ingest workers, drain the dead-letter queue, and restart the resizer pods two at a time. Do not flush the queue outright; originals are only retained for six hours. For the eng sync, reference the last healthy deployment by the token below.

build token for yajof-bajof: htk31_506ff1188f74596b5bb2eec94edc43c

# Dependency pinning policy for the Thornwell gateway.
# All third-party packages are pinned to exact versions; ranges are
# forbidden, including for transitive dependencies, which are locked
# via the resolved manifest. Upgrades require a reviewed diff of the
# lockfile and a fresh scan. Reviewers should verify this constant
# matches the manifest hash. The build it was generated from is
# recorded below.

pipeline stamp: htk31_f769b577b3028a4e9958e5bb8d1259a

### Runbook: Quillmark Renderer Release (fragment)

Before shipping the markdown pipeline update, double-check that the sanitizer stage runs *after* the macro expander — we got bitten by that ordering in the Larkspur incident. Build artifacts come out of the Penwood CI lane and must be signed before they hit the render fleet; unsigned bundles get rejected at ingest, which is by design. For verification during review, the release artifacts are signed with the key below.

signing key of bagap-yawep = bky13_TbfT6ZMUoGJo2